Job Description:

The Contract Management Intern will support the Legal, Contracts and Compliance Department by assisting with contract administration, legal research, document management, compliance activities, and operational projects. This role offers an excellent opportunity for a student pursuing a degree in Law, Business, Public Administration, or a related field to gain practical experience in providing commercial contract management support and develop an understanding of contract lifecycle management and corporate legal processes.

Key Accountabilities

Contract Management Support

  • Assist with the preparation, review, formatting, and organization of contracts and legal documents.
  • Support the contract lifecycle process, including tracking, execution, amendments, and archiving.
  • Maintain contract databases and document repositories to ensure records are accurate and up to date.
  • Assist contract managers with day-to-day contract management activities.
  • Attend project meetings.

Compliance & Risk Management

  • Support compliance initiatives by reviewing and organizing policies, procedures, and training materials.
  • Assist with due diligence reviews as needed.
  • Help track legal and regulatory developments that may impact the organization.

Administrative & Operational Support

  • Organize and maintain electronic and physical legal files.
  • Assist with preparing standard legal templates and forms.
  • Support the coordination of document execution and signature processes.
  • Participate in special projects aimed at improving legal operations and contract management processes including Artificial Intelligence initiatives for the department.

Cross-Functional Collaboration

  • Liaise with internal stakeholders across Procurement, Finance, Sales and Bids teams to obtain
  • information required for contracts and legal reviews.
  • Assist with responding to routine inquiries regarding contracts, processes, and document status

About Hitachi

Since its founding in 1910, Hitachi has responded to the expectations of society and its customers through technology and innovation. Our mission is to “Contribute to society through the development of superior, original technology and products.” Over the past 100+ years this commitment has led us to work towards creating a more sustainable society through our “Social Innovation Business”. We work to apply our expertise in information technology (IT), operational technology (OT), and a wide variety of products to advance social infrastructure systems and improve quality of life across the world.

Hitachi’s Social Innovation Business is centered around 5 growth sectors: Mobility, Smart Life, Industry, Energy, and IT. Globally, we have nearly 300,000 employees who are working to improve people’s quality of life and our customers’ social, environmental, and economic values to create a sustainable future.
